import { describe, expect, mock, test } from 'bun:test';
describe('deferred OpenCode restart helpers', () => {
test('isDeferredRestartPayload detects deferred responses', async () => {
const { isDeferredRestartPayload } = await import('./deferredRestart');
expect(isDeferredRestartPayload({
requiresReload: false,
requiresRestart: true,
restartDeferred: true,
})).toBe(true);
expect(isDeferredRestartPayload({
requiresReload: false,
requiresRestart: true,
})).toBe(true);
expect(isDeferredRestartPayload({
requiresReload: true,
message: 'reloading',
})).toBe(false);
expect(isDeferredRestartPayload({
requiresManualRestart: true,
requiresRestart: true,
restartDeferred: true,
})).toBe(false);
});
test('noteDeferredRestartFromPayload records pending changes', async () => {
const { usePendingOpenCodeRestartStore } = await import('@/stores/usePendingOpenCodeRestartStore');
usePendingOpenCodeRestartStore.getState().clear();
const { noteDeferredRestartFromPayload } = await import('./deferredRestart');
const noted = noteDeferredRestartFromPayload({
requiresReload: false,
requiresRestart: true,
restartDeferred: true,
}, 'mcp', { id: 'filesystem' });
expect(noted).toBe(true);
expect(usePendingOpenCodeRestartStore.getState().changes).toHaveLength(1);
expect(usePendingOpenCodeRestartStore.getState().changes[0]?.scope).toBe('mcp');
});
test('noteDeferredRestartFromPayload ignores non-deferred payloads', async () => {
const { usePendingOpenCodeRestartStore } = await import('@/stores/usePendingOpenCodeRestartStore');
usePendingOpenCodeRestartStore.getState().clear();
const { noteDeferredRestartFromPayload } = await import('./deferredRestart');
const noted = noteDeferredRestartFromPayload({
requiresReload: false,
message: 'Provider was not connected',
}, 'providers', { id: 'openai' });
expect(noted).toBe(false);
expect(usePendingOpenCodeRestartStore.getState().changes).toHaveLength(0);
});
test('applyPendingOpenCodeRestart clears pending changes after success', async () => {
mock.module('@/stores/useAgentsStore', () => ({
reloadOpenCodeConfiguration: async () => undefined,
}));
const { usePendingOpenCodeRestartStore } = await import('@/stores/usePendingOpenCodeRestartStore');
usePendingOpenCodeRestartStore.getState().clear();
usePendingOpenCodeRestartStore.getState().recordChange({ scope: 'agents', id: 'demo' });
const { applyPendingOpenCodeRestart } = await import('./deferredRestart');
const result = await applyPendingOpenCodeRestart({ message: 'Applying…' });
expect(result).toEqual({ ok: true });
expect(usePendingOpenCodeRestartStore.getState().changes).toHaveLength(0);
expect(usePendingOpenCodeRestartStore.getState().isApplying).toBe(false);
});
test('applyPendingOpenCodeRestart clears pending changes on manual restart', async () => {
mock.module('@/stores/useAgentsStore', () => ({
reloadOpenCodeConfiguration: async () => {
const error = new Error('Restart your connected OpenCode server');
(error as Error & { requiresManualRestart?: boolean }).requiresManualRestart = true;
throw error;
},
}));
const { usePendingOpenCodeRestartStore } = await import('@/stores/usePendingOpenCodeRestartStore');
usePendingOpenCodeRestartStore.getState().clear();
usePendingOpenCodeRestartStore.getState().recordChange({ scope: 'mcp', id: 'filesystem' });
const { applyPendingOpenCodeRestart } = await import('./deferredRestart');
const result = await applyPendingOpenCodeRestart({ message: 'Applying…' });
expect(result).toEqual({ ok: false, requiresManualRestart: true });
expect(usePendingOpenCodeRestartStore.getState().changes).toHaveLength(0);
expect(usePendingOpenCodeRestartStore.getState().isApplying).toBe(false);
});
});
